The U.S. Forest Service on Monday rescinded its proposed ban that was to be in effect during the season which begins Thursday, Dec. 6 and runs through Dec. 13.
The decision came prior to a hearing scheduled in federal district court on a Louisiana Sportsman Alliance suit seeking a preliminary injunction on the ban until a hearing could be held.
The USFS did not comment on its action.
The Alliance wants hunters to have the right to run their dogs and chase deer on the forest’s thousands of acres as they have done for decades.
